India is making its communication systems safer and stronger by launching 14 local quantum products. These products were made by the Centre for Development of Telematics (C-DOT), which is the research and development part of the Department of Telecommunications (DoT) in the Ministry of Communications.
The products were shown at C-DOT’s 43rd Foundation Day in New Delhi. They include Quantum Key Distribution (QKD), Post-Quantum Cryptography (PQC), secure encryption, and special parts for quantum communication systems. This collection is made for use in telecom, business, wireless, optical, strategic, and defense networks.
Expanding quantum-safe communications
The portfolio has two ways to improve quantum security. QKD technology helps create and share secure quantum keys. PQC-based methods use special math techniques to protect against risks from new quantum computers.
Q-AKSHAY CD is one of the QKD products. It is a small, fibre-based system that uses Coherent One Way and Differential Phase Shift methods to create and send secure quantum keys over fibre networks. Q-AKSHAY MD uses the Measurement Device Independent method and aims to tackle flaws linked to measurement devices.
C-DOT has created special parts for quantum communication systems. C-SPD is a Single-Photon Detector, and C-RD is an RF driver that works with a wide range of frequencies. It helps control intensity and phase modulators in quantum communication systems.
Quantum-safe protection across networks
The wider portfolio includes solutions to protect communication over different network layers and operating environments.
Q-SETU is a safe encryptor for Layer 3 communications. It can handle speeds up to 80 Mbps. Q-MAHASETU works with Layer 2/3 networks and supports speeds up to 40 Gbps. Both use NIST PQC algorithms.
Q-VIKRAM and Q-PARAKRAM are strong encryptors for defense and communication. They can handle speeds up to 1 Gbps for Layer 2/3 networks. Q-AMOG offers safe protection for fast optical communications, with speeds up to 200 Gbps at Layer 1.
The portfolio also offers quantum-safe protection for communication and access systems. Q-DARSHAN is a quantum-safe video phone, and Q-VACHAN is a device that adds quantum security to IP phones. Q-RAQSHAK is for business networks, Q-VAAYU protects wireless connections, and Q-VAJRA1000 upgrades current communication networks with quantum security, including GPON and wireless radios.
Building an indigenous quantum ecosystem
The 14 products together offer a range that includes quantum-safe encryption, secure communication, and important parts for quantum communication systems. This means C-DOT’s quantum program covers telecom networks, business infrastructure, wireless and optical communication, and also defense and strategic uses.
The technologies show C-DOT’s work in both QKD and PQC, not just one method for secure quantum communications. The special parts made by the group aim to help grow quantum communication systems and safe security solutions for current and future networks.
A new booklet called the Quantum Product Series was launched at the event. It shows C-DOT’s homegrown quantum solutions. The booklet talks about the group’s work in QKD and PQC and its goal to create safe, strong, and future-ready communication tech.
The launch shows C-DOT’s goal of turning local research and ideas into better communication networks for India as it gets ready for the new quantum age.
